Sustainable Food System - Holiday Hunger & Community Food Resilience
Flintshire County Council is seeking to appoint a suitably experienced provider to design, mobilise and deliver a sustainable, Ultra-Processed Food (UPF) free food system across the County.
This procurement forms a key part of the Council’s wider approach to tackling food insecurity, improving dietary health outcomes, and strengthening long-term community resilience.
Contract Overview
The successful Provider will be required to:
- Deliver an affordable, nutritious, UPF-free food offer
- Provide year-round access, with enhanced delivery during school holiday periods
- Mobilise an initial operational phase by mid-July 2026 to support summer holiday provision
- Develop and implement a financially sustainable model reducing Council funding from Year 1 (£400,000) to £0 by Year 5
- Work collaboratively with community organisations, local suppliers and public sector partners
- The contract will commence on 1 June 2026 and will run for a period of five years with an option to extend for a further 2 years to 31/05/2033 subject to alternative funding model being put in place by the contractor.
Strategic Objectives
The Council is seeking a provider that can:
- Embed a whole-system approach to food access
- Improve health and wellbeing through high-quality, minimally processed food
- Strengthen local supply chains and maximise local economic benefit
- Deliver measurable social and environmental impact
- Build community capacity and reduce long-term dependency
Funding Profile
This contract is structured around a tapered funding model. Council funding will reduce annually across the five-year term. Bidders must demonstrate credible financial sustainability and income diversification to ensure the service remains viable beyond Year 5.

- The Supplier will organise workshops, in 'sprint'-style format, to support Nest Invest to form views on design aspects or operational approaches for its retirement income blueprint, which include but are not limited to the following:
1.Assessment of choice of CMA model, and support making any changes
2.Income calibration sessions (setting initial income, high-level investment strategy, adjusting the income framework)
3.Approach for early retirees (reducing volatility though income framework)
4.Choice of comparator annuities
5.Detailed decisions on cohorting (age-related simplifications and allowing for significant market movements, also related work on cross subsidies)
6. Detailed investment strategy considerations
7. Price-lock considerations with the insurer
8. Governance of cohorts
The supplier will also prepare pre-reading materials and papers documenting the outcomes of workshops, for subjects relating to the retirement income blueprint, including the subjects above.

- The project will build a healthcare led energy safeguarding network across the GDN areas, delivered in partnership with National Energy Action in England and Wales and Energy Action Scotland in Scotland. It will focus on identifying, training and supporting health care organisations so they can confidently and sustainably help local households in, or at risk of, an energy crisis. Delivery will continue through a nationally coordinated model, with NEA leading delivery while continuing to work with local partners to collectively provide frontline support, underpinned by strengthened quality assurance, evaluation and learning. The activities involved in delivering this project collectively represent thousands of additional touchpoints that extend the project's impact beyond individual casework, into whole communities and professional systems. This package of support will ultimately improve safety, address affordability and wellbeing for vulnerable households, while strengthening local systems and reducing duplication across VCMA portfolios.
WHHF addresses gaps in service provisions by embedding fuel poverty and energy vulnerability within health and social care pathways, enabling trusted professionals to identify risk and connect households to
practical support before harm occurs. Evidence from NEA's Impact Report shows that in 2024 to 2025 professional extended reach to an estimated 3.85 million people, based on 6,783 individual professionals trained. This demonstrates the significant multiplier effect of professional training and its contribution to population-level prevention.
The programme objectives are to:
• Support customers in vulnerable situations to remain warm, safe and healthy at home
• Reduce the risk of carbon monoxide harm
• Improve household financial resilience through income maximisation
• Strengthen professional capability across health and community services
• Embed energy safeguarding within local health systems
• Deliver measurable social value and positive SROI
Working with all GDNs, NEA, EAS and their contract partners will support those living in or at risk of fuel poverty, by delivering the following services:
• Energy casework
• Benefits advice
• Benefit claim support
• Referrals into GDN for the servicing, repair and replacement of essential gas appliances
• CO alarms
• Community energy efficiency training
• Community CO awareness training
• Frontline worker training
Delivery is tailored within each participating GDN network area, reflecting existing VCMA portfolios, NHS and voluntary sector partnerships, and local deprivation and health inequality data.

- The British Business Bank (the Bank) is a government-owned economic development bank that makes finance markets for smaller businesses work more effectively. Our mission is to drive economic growth by helping smaller businesses get the finance they need to start, scale and stay in the UK. In doing so, we help capture the economic value of innovation for the UK and create jobs and prosperity for people across the country. The Bank designs programmes that provide funds and guarantees to private sector partners, enabling them to finance a greater number of smaller businesses, either through debt or equity. It uses economic evidence so that its programmes address market failures affecting smaller businesses across the economy. It also works to improve smaller businesses’ awareness of the finance options available to them.
Nations and Regions Investments Limited (NRIL) is a wholly owned subsidiary of the British Business Bank that manages a number of investment schemes for the Department for Business and Trade (DBT), including the proposed South East Investment Fund (SEIF) and East of England Investment Fund (EEIF). NRIL is the Contracting Authority for this procurement.
In the 2025 Spending Review, the Government announced an extension of the Nations and Regions Investment Funds (NRIF) programme to include £350m to be made available for the South East and the East of England regions. The funds are to be allocated according to the following split:
- £210m for the South East Investment Fund (SEIF)
- £140m for the East of England Investment Fund (EEIF)
Within each region the funding will be split into two sub-funds: one for Equity (approximately 60% - offering early stage and later stage equity investments up to £5m); and one for Debt (approximately 40% - offering business loans of between £25,000 and £2m). A proportion of each fund will be held back (“Investor Reserve”) and may be added as additional funding (“Additional Allocation”) depending on circumstances and particular factors. Tenderers are expected to have some regional experience and a track record of funding viable Small and Medium Enterprises (SMEs) that are looking to grow. Tenderers should be aligned to the Programme Objectives, that the funds will:
- increase the supply and diversity of early-stage finance for UK smaller businesses, providing funds to firms that might otherwise not receive investment and helping to reduce disparities in access to finance;
- be run in a commercially sustainable way to promote a shift away from an expectation of public sector grants towards a culture of borrowing and investing for growth;
- drive sustainable economic growth through supporting new and growing businesses across the UK with an inclusive approach to all eligible sectors;
- have a demonstrable presence across the relevant geographical area linking up the finance community to increase reach and create an impact beyond the funds, helping to boost productivity, innovation and jobs;
- align with the Bank’s commitments to net zero by 2050 and promoting diversity, equity and inclusion in the distribution of finance.
It is expected that NRIL will begin making investment commitments to the SEIF and EEIF Fund Managers in Summer 2026. The duration of the Contract Services will be:
- Investment Period: The first 5 years of the fund during which the Fund can make new investments. This period can be extended by up to two years at the sole discretion of NRIL.
- Realisation: the period beginning immediately after the Investment Period and ending on the date which is 5 years after the end of the Investment Period (which will include the ability of the SEIF and EEIF Fund Managers to make follow-on investments in portfolio businesses). This period can be extended by up to two years at the sole discretion of NRIL.
